How to Make Money with Your Hands: A Comprehensive Guide

Have you ever wondered how to turn your hands into a source of income? Whether you’re a craft enthusiast, a DIY aficionado, or simply looking for a unique way to make money, there are numerous opportunities out there. In this article, we’ll explore various ways you can make money with your hands, from crafting and selling items to providing services and more.

1. Crafting and Selling Items

Crafting is a popular way to make money with your hands. From handmade jewelry to custom art pieces, there’s a vast market for unique and personalized items. Here are some steps to get started:

  • Identify your niche: What are you passionate about? What do you excel at? Find a niche that you can focus on and create items that cater to that specific market.

  • Learn the basics: Whether it’s knitting, painting, or woodworking, take the time to learn the basics of your chosen craft. This will help you create high-quality items that customers will love.

  • Set up an online store: Platforms like Etsy, eBay, and Amazon make it easy to sell your handmade items. Create a compelling shop description and high-quality images to attract customers.

  • Market your products: Utilize social media, online forums, and local events to promote your products. Engage with your audience and build a loyal customer base.

2. Providing Services

Offering services is another great way to make money with your hands. Here are some popular service-based businesses you can consider:

  • Handyman services: If you have a knack for fixing things, consider offering handyman services. This can include tasks like painting, repairing furniture, or installing shelves.

  • Personal trainer: If you’re knowledgeable about fitness and exercise, you can offer personal training services. This can be done in person or virtually through video calls.

  • Massage therapist: If you have experience in massage therapy, you can offer your services in a private practice or at a spa.

  • Photography: If you have a passion for photography, you can offer your services for events, portraits, or even stock photography.

3. Teaching and Tutoring

Sharing your skills and knowledge can be a rewarding way to make money with your hands. Here are some teaching and tutoring opportunities:

  • Online courses: Create and sell online courses on platforms like Udemy, Teachable, or Skillshare. Share your expertise on topics you’re passionate about.

  • Private tutoring: Offer private tutoring services in subjects like math, science, or language arts. You can tutor students of all ages, from children to adults.

  • Workshops and classes: Host workshops or classes in your area, focusing on your area of expertise. This can be a great way to connect with like-minded individuals and make money.
